Handling confidential information is a critical responsibility for security guards due to the sensitive nature of their work. When security guards manage confidential information with discretion, they adhere to established protocols meant to protect the integrity of that information. This means ensuring that only those individuals who are authorized to access this information do so, thereby maintaining trust and confidentiality. This safeguard not only protects the organization but also the individuals involved.

In the context of security operations, sharing sensitive information with unauthorized individuals can lead to security breaches, compromise safety, and damage reputations. Therefore, it is vital for security guards to be vigilant and responsible in their approach to confidentiality, ensuring that discussions about sensitive matters are conducted only with the appropriate parties involved. Compliance with these practices reflects a commitment to the ethical standards of the profession and reinforces the importance of confidentiality within the security field.
